In this episode of #TNTalks, Emily Kittrell from NISTS checks in with three members of this year’s #TransferStudentWeek Planning Committee — Dr. Doreen Hatcher, Dr. Kelly Coke, and Tracey Sohner — to talk about what they have seen and how they have supported transfer students who navigated their transition between institutions during the COVID-19 pandemic. If you have been wondering how lockdown and virtual operations unfolded at other colleges and universities, tune in to the conversation to learn how three different institutions adapted to meet the needs of their transfer students.

For more than 25 years, Doreen Hatcher has served as a university administrator with a passion for helping students transition to college through meaningful engagement while finding a balance between school, life, and work. Currently, Dr. Hatcher is the director for Student Transition and Engagement Programs at Cal State Channel Islands.

Dr. Kelly Coke recently earned her doctorate in Organizational Leadership with a content area in Higher Education from Abilene Christian University in 2021. She currently serves as Instructor of Adult Education and Leadership Studies, Program Coordinator of Bachelor of General Studies, and Director of (Off Campus) Programs for A&M-Texarkana at Northeast Texas Community College and Paris Junior College.

Tracey Sohner is a Retention Specialist at Cal State Fullerton. She provides General Education Advising to students of all class levels and specialized support for at-risk, transfer, first-gen students, and freshman within the College of the Arts.
